The GF and I are looking for a sled for her, she really likes the MXZ 600 ACE. We looked at the phasers she doesn't like the way it looks and the seating position, and the vector is out of the price range. Anybody have an opinion on the 600 ACE? The dealer says it based off one of the watercraft engines which they have had no trouble with.
 
60hp.... There was a serious recall on them, but only affected a certain amount of them. To the point that dealers were told not to run them.... I believe they are fixed now. Just beware of it...
 
Thanks good to know, looks like it was some issue with oil pump bolts being to long or something, seems like they got it fixed now.
 
They're fine. The recall was way over exaggerated. They are supposed to have about the same power as their 550 Fan, and be "electric smooth". A disappointing 22-ish mpg, but maybe not broke in? Besides that, everybody that i've talked to, or read about loves them and say they have a "little more' then they would've thought for 60 hp. ?
 
I've read mid to low 20s mpg, more if you get the model with the .75" track. With a top speed of around 75ish, 80 mph is possible with a very long run, on a broken in motor I guess.

If you are alright with that kind of speed, they sound like an awesome sled, light weight and great handling

I got to ride one for a bit, seems like a great replacement for the fan cooled class. The one I was on had 121" track. Speed was OK, the guy managed to run side by side with my Phazer up to 77 on my speedo which is about 72mph gps. Accleration was so so I could hold my phazer at a little over 3/4 throttle and run side by side with him on the up. It had 500 miles on it. Felt FRONT heavy though, not nearly as balanced as my Phazer BUT seemed to handle corners better due to the lower center of gravity AND being front heavy.

QUIET, noticably quieter than the stock exhaust was on my phazer. The guy claimed he was getting 22-23mpg while "breaking it in" at 30-50 mph with NO aggressive acceleration , I get 19-21mpg with my 144" Phazer under the same conditions.

His comments on my Phazer, TIPPY and QUICK . He was actually kinda mad as his dealer told him that the 600ace was comparable to the Phazer powerwise, and had better torque since the engine was "bigger". Not a bad sled, but the price is too much for what you get. MAYBE yamaha will have a lighter cruiser style sled with the phazer or phazer replecement engine under the hood for 2012.
